The Council of the Inns of Court (COIC) is a charity with the object of advancing education in the administration and practice of the law, by promoting high standards of advocacy and by enforcing professional standards of conduct amongst barristers. COIC advances the former through the activities of the Inns of Court College of Advocacy (the ICCA) and the latter through the work of the Bar Tribunals and Adjudication Service (BTAS).
The Inns of Court College of Advocacy
The ICCA delivers a not-for-profit postgraduate Bar Course which features innovative admissions policies to attract a diverse cohort of students, and provides high-quality CPD, education and training materials to practising barristers.
The Bar Tribunals and Adjudication Service
BTAS administers Disciplinary Tribunals, Fitness to Practise and other hearings for barristers. BTAS does not investigate or prosecute alleged misconduct itself, but instead it performs the vital role of ensuring the fairness and independence of the hearing process.
